Slate窗口吸附功能终极指南:精准对齐的10个实用技巧

想要在Mac上实现窗口的精准对齐和快速布局吗?Slate窗口管理工具的吸附功能正是你需要的解决方案!作为一款强大的开源窗口管理应用,Slate提供了简单易用的窗口吸附功能,让你的工作空间更加整洁高效。

【免费下载链接】slate A window management application (replacement for Divvy/SizeUp/ShiftIt) 【免费下载链接】slate 项目地址: https://gitcode.com/gh_mirrors/slate/slate

🎯 什么是Slate窗口吸附功能?

Slate的窗口吸附功能(Corner Operations)允许你将窗口快速吸附到屏幕的四个角落:左上角、右上角、左下角和右下角。这个功能特别适合多任务处理,让你能够轻松创建完美的工作区域布局。

🔧 快速配置Slate吸附功能

基础配置步骤

  1. 安装Slate:通过Homebrew安装或从gitcode.com/gh_mirrors/slate/slate下载
  2. 创建配置文件:在用户目录下创建.slate文件
  3. 添加吸附命令:在配置文件中设置corner操作

配置文件示例

Slate/default.slate文件中,你可以看到基础的窗口管理配置。虽然默认配置中没有直接包含corner操作,但你可以轻松添加:

# 添加角落吸附绑定
bind q:ctrl;alt corner top-left
bind w:ctrl;alt corner top-right
bind a:ctrl;alt corner bottom-left
bind s:ctrl;alt corner bottom-right

💡 10个实用吸附技巧

1. 四角快速吸附

使用快捷键将窗口吸附到屏幕四个角落,这是最基础的吸附操作:

corner top-left     # 吸附到左上角
corner top-right    # 吸附到右上角  
corner bottom-left  # 吸附到左下角
corner bottom-right # 吸附到右下角

2. 自定义吸附尺寸

除了默认的窗口尺寸,你还可以指定吸附时的窗口大小:

corner top-left resize:screenSizeX/2;screenSizeY/2

3. 多显示器支持

在多显示器环境下,指定目标显示器进行吸附:

corner top-left monitor:1  # 吸附到第一个显示器的左上角

窗口吸附效果

4. 组合操作技巧

将吸附功能与其他操作结合使用,创建更复杂的工作流:

# 吸附到右上角并调整大小
corner top-right resize:800;600

5. 智能吸附配置

Slate/CornerOperation.m中,你可以看到吸附功能的完整实现逻辑,包括坐标计算和屏幕边缘检测。

6. 快速切换布局

使用不同的吸附组合快速切换工作布局,比如:

  • 编程模式:代码编辑器在左侧,文档在右侧
  • 设计模式:设计工具在左侧,预览窗口在右侧

7. 保留窗口比例

在吸附时保持窗口的原始宽高比,避免内容变形。

8. 边缘吸附优化

确保窗口在吸附时不会超出屏幕边缘,保持界面的整洁性。

9. 批量操作技巧

通过脚本或快捷键序列,一次性对多个窗口进行吸附布局。

10. 个性化配置

根据你的工作习惯,创建个性化的吸附快捷键组合。

🚀 高级使用场景

开发工作环境

  • 将IDE吸附到左侧,占据屏幕的2/3宽度
  • 将终端吸附到右侧底部
  • 将浏览器吸附到右侧顶部

创意工作流程

  • 设计工具占据整个左侧屏幕
  • 素材库吸附在右侧顶部
  • 预览窗口吸附在右侧底部

📊 吸附功能核心优势

提升工作效率:减少手动调整窗口的时间 保持界面整洁:避免窗口重叠和混乱 支持多任务:轻松管理多个应用程序窗口

🔍 常见问题解决

吸附不准确?

检查屏幕分辨率设置和Slate配置是否正确。参考Slate/Constants.m中的相关常量定义。

快捷键冲突?

重新配置快捷键组合,避免与系统或其他应用程序冲突。

💎 总结

Slate的窗口吸附功能是提升Mac工作效率的终极工具。通过本文介绍的10个实用技巧,你可以轻松掌握窗口精准对齐的艺术,打造完美的工作空间布局。无论是编程、设计还是日常办公,这些技巧都能让你的工作流程更加流畅高效!

开始使用Slate的吸附功能,体验窗口管理的全新境界!✨

【免费下载链接】slate A window management application (replacement for Divvy/SizeUp/ShiftIt) 【免费下载链接】slate 项目地址: https://gitcode.com/gh_mirrors/slate/slate

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值